This handsome rectangular tufa cast belt buckle by well-known Navajo silversmith Tommy Jackson, has a classic heavy-gauge sterling silver frame with softly rounded corners. It features a rich, textured surface created through the tufa cast process, a traditional Navajo sand-casting technique using volcanic tuff stone that leaves behind this distinctive, slightly rough, and organic-looking finish on the silver. The center motif is a bold diamond shape inlaid with bright orange coral, containing a small cabochon at its heart inlaid with natural Kingman turquoise prized for its vibrant colors, unique matrix patterns and rich historical significance in Native American culture. The piece shows a nice patina with some natural oxidation, enhancing the depth and character of the casting. This is a solid, wearable example of traditional tufa-cast Navajo silverwork with strong visual impact.
